[PATCH 00/18] KVM: arm64: Support FEAT_PMUv3 on Apple hardware

Will Deacon will at kernel.org
Fri Jan 10 08:22:49 PST 2025


On Tue, 17 Dec 2024 13:20:30 -0800, Oliver Upton wrote:
> One of the interesting features of some Apple M* parts is an IMPDEF trap
> that routes EL1/EL0 accesses of the PMUv3 registers to EL2. This allows
> a hypervisor to emulate an architectural PMUv3 on top of the IMPDEF PMU
> hardware present in the CPU.
> 
> And if you squint, this _might_ look like a CPU erratum :-)
> 
> [...]

Applied the branch events patch to will (for-next/perf), thanks!

[03/18] drivers/perf: apple_m1: Map generic branch events
        https://git.kernel.org/will/c/4575353d82e2

Cheers,
-- 
Will

https://fixes.arm64.dev
https://next.arm64.dev
https://will.arm64.dev



More information about the linux-arm-kernel mailing list